WebSep 19, 2024 · In the case of diarrhea, alcohol inflames the stomach, intestines, colon, and sometimes even the rectum. This inflammation places undue pressure upon the organs, and can result in diarrhea. 2. Faster digestion. When alcohol is consumed, it speeds up the body’s normal rate of digestion. If you see … dwi school is whatWebJun 23, 2024 · The symptoms of overhydration look a lot like those of dehydration, according to Hew-Butler. When you drink too much water, your kidneys become unable to get rid of the excess liquid, and water starts to collect in the body.
